Hydronephrosis and the Use of Stents for Treatment

Hydronephrosis is a medical condition characterized by the swelling of one or both kidneys due to a buildup of urine. This occurs when there is an obstruction in the urinary tract that prevents urine from flowing freely from the kidneys to the bladder. Common causes of hydronephrosis include kidney stones, tumors, congenital abnormalities, and strictures in the urinary tract.

When left untreated, hydronephrosis can lead to significant kidney damage, affecting kidney function and leading to complications such as urinary tract infections or chronic kidney disease. Therefore, timely diagnosis and intervention are crucial for managing this condition.

One effective treatment option for hydronephrosis is the use of stents. Ureteral stenting involves the insertion of a thin tube (stent) into the ureter, the tube that carries urine from the kidney to the bladder. This stent helps to open up any blockage, allowing urine to flow freely and alleviating the swelling caused by hydronephrosis.

The procedure for placing a stent is often performed under local or general anesthesia, depending on the patient's condition and the complexity of the case. A cystoscope—a thin tube with a camera—is typically used to guide the placement of the stent. This minimally invasive approach allows for a quicker recovery time and less discomfort compared to more extensive surgical options.

Stents can remain in place for varying periods, typically ranging from a few weeks to several months, depending on the underlying cause of hydronephrosis and the individual patient’s needs. Regular follow-up appointments are necessary to monitor the condition and ensure that the stent is functioning properly.

Patients may experience mild side effects after stent placement, including increased urinary frequency, urgency, and mild discomfort. In some cases, patients may require a non-steroidal anti-inflammatory drug (NSAID) to manage any discomfort during the healing process.

In cases where hydronephrosis is caused by kidney stones, additional treatment may be necessary. Once the obstruction is resolved, further intervention may be needed to remove the stones and prevent future occurrences.

Stenting is an effective solution for managing hydronephrosis; however, it is essential to address the underlying cause of the blockage for long-term resolution. Other treatment options may include surgery to remove tumors or strictures causing the obstruction or endoscopic techniques to break up kidney stones.
